}J}tT;g-`&u5|0 The first part of TOEIC consists of twenty numbered photographs that are in your test book. For each photograph, you will hear on the audio program four sentences that refer to it. You must decide which of the sentences best describes something you can see in each photograph.
:\f xV4f;xS3B n0/BV*l3q!`,p\0 The photographs are pictures of ordinary situations. Around two-thirds of the photographs involve a person or people; around one-third involve an object or a scene without people.
k9@1L%N.Lf}0G({1l"K.{/z f:C)KO3i0 The sentences are short and grammatically simple. They generally deal with the most important aspects of the photographs, but some focus on small details or on objects or people in the background.
:dk C+[#K c4F0$zdU*Z1m2t-g0 Each item is introduced by a statement that tells you to look at the next numbered photograph. The pacing for this part is fast: There is only a five-second pause between items, and there is no pause between sentences (A), (B), (C), and (D).

g-}0}&e6pIA`}0 1. Always complete each item as quickly as possible so that you can preview the photograph for the next item. Don't wait for the statement that says, "Now look at photograph number __. "51Testing软件测试网+Fu!C^m3z EO
51Testing软件测试网#[%z;j5aL3u9Py e XN2. If you are previewing a photograph that involves a person or people, look for aspects of the photographs that are often mentioned in the sentences:51Testing软件测试网hx eU4ue.PA
51Testing软件测试网+p\:uK x4z L * What are the people doing?

gI0 * Where are they?51Testing软件测试网;}0f ]#l%A6P*r
* Who are they? (Is there a uniform. or piece of equipment or anything else that indicates their profession or role?)
tG2VS9`0 * What distinguishes them? (Is there a hat, a mustache, a puree, a pair of glasses, a tie, or anything else that differentiates the people?)
:OZ(z.D,y_4O0 * What do the people's expressions tell you? (Do they look happy? Unhappy? Excited? Bored? Upset?)
3. If you are previewing a photograph of an object, focus on these aspects:51Testing软件测试网N&j jj8zKP
51Testing软件测试网:K8f$g F6y!f;e * What is it?

eg,cE0 * What is it made of?51Testing软件测试网2x8ST@1T
* What —— if anything —— is it doing?51Testing软件测试网!MB4BD4p6B K1y
* Where is it?
5iq-FS/~-X.z?0 4. If you are previewing a photograph of a scene, focus on these aspects:51Testing软件测试网4ET9Z[#hz GH
51Testing软件测试网we ItDP2Et * Where is it?51Testing软件测试网J,}|5~XG
* What is in the foreground (the "front" of the picture)?
D@z7Q-Qv2T/~H0 * What —— if anything —— is happening?51Testing软件测试网F/k qix
* What is in the background (the "distant" part of the picture)?51Testing软件测试网 J]k!? \*`Z8l|
5. Don't mark an answer until you have heard all four choices. When you hear a choice that you think is correct, rest your pencil on that oval on your answer sheet. If you change your mind and hear a sentence that you think is better, move your pencil to that choice. Once you have heard all four sentences, mark the oval that your pencil is resting on. (This technique helps you remember which choice you think is best.)51Testing软件测试网w(Grs J3_]q
51Testing软件测试网!e$|1U dA0_6O3]6. Try to eliminate choices with problems in meaning, sound, and sound + meaning.
*FrTq6P0SPD/A6f051Testing软件测试网O-V`4?6QfmCI i0M+Q7. Most correct answers involve verbs in the simple present ("The furniture looks new.") or present progressive tense ("The woman is riding a bicycle."). Be suspicious of answer choices involving any other tenses.51Testing软件测试网Z0i,v!?$J5KB p
51Testing软件测试网3SUr [s2bW8. Never leave any blanks. Always guess before going on to the next item.51Testing软件测试网+vg"]9C6pg9z!~;O
51Testing软件测试网{9BjX0w N'T9. As soon as you have finished marking the answer, stop looking at andthinkingabout that photograph and move on to the next item.

This part of TOEIC consists of thirty items. Each item consists of a question on the audio program followed by three possible responses (answers) to the question, also on the audio program. Your job is to decide which of these three best answers the question. Between each item is a five-second pause. Part II problems do not involve any reading skills; therefore, this part is considered a "pure" test of listening skills. Your test book simply tells you to mark an answer for each problem.

1. There are no answer choices to consider before or while the item is being read. You should just concentrate on the question and the three responses on the audio program, and pay no attention to the test book.
f e4c2c:m@V051Testing软件测试网FR6B\&S%A|Uz]3nk2. Try to identify the type of question (information question, yes/no question, alternative question, and so on). The correct response, of course, often depends on the type of question being asked.51Testing软件测试网O[0XJ#J)M"cNr
51Testing软件测试网0k i:rY b YjT!L3. Try to eliminate distractors.
ud%`._ y _ Y.w[0g}qu4DUIF0 4. Don't mark an answer until you have heard all three responses. When you hear a response that you think is correct, rest your pencil on that oval on the answer sheet. If you change your mind and hear a response that you think is better, move your pencil to that choice. Once you have heard all three responses, mark the oval that your pencil is resting on. (This technique helps you remember which choice you think is best.)
U%xZM%t+v^p051Testing软件测试网 zp W ]i+c3M5. If you hear all three responses and none of the three seems correct, take a guess and get ready for the next item.51Testing软件测试网7E M'v']Sbe/^ E @
51Testing软件测试网1O qsU0@Ox6. There is very little time (only five seconds) between items in Part II. You need to decide on an answer and fill in the blank quickly to be ready for the next item.51Testing软件测试网!l8^oq Ny:Tl-c
